# WebDriver BiDi module: permissions
"""
WebDriver BiDi permissions module.

Provides control over browser permission grants during automated tests,
as specified by the W3C Permissions specification.

Typical usage::

    driver.permissions.set_permission('geolocation', 'granted', origin)
"""

from __future__ import annotations

from dataclasses import dataclass
from typing import Any

from selenium.webdriver.common.bidi.common import command_builder

class PermissionState:
    """
    Permission state constants.

    GRANTED: The permission is granted — the browser will not prompt the user.
    DENIED:  The permission is denied — the browser will block the request.
    PROMPT:  The browser will show a permission prompt (default browser behaviour).
    """

    GRANTED = "granted"
    DENIED = "denied"
    PROMPT = "prompt"

class PermissionDescriptor:
    """Descriptor identifying a permission by name.

    Args:
        name: The permission name (e.g. 'geolocation', 'microphone', 'camera').
    """

    def __init__(self, name: str) -> None:
        self.name = name

    def __repr__(self) -> str:
        return f"PermissionDescriptor(name={self.name!r})"

class Permissions:
    """
    BiDi interface for controlling browser permissions.

    Access via ``driver.permissions``.
    """

    def __init__(self, conn) -> None:
        self._conn = conn

    def set_permission(
        self,
        descriptor: "PermissionDescriptor | str",
        state: "PermissionState | str",
        origin: str | None = None,
        user_context: str | None = None,
        *,
        embedded_origin: str | None = None,
    ) -> None:
        """Set a browser permission.

        Args:
            descriptor: The permission descriptor or permission name as a string.
            state: The desired permission state (granted, denied, or prompt).
            origin: The origin to scope the permission to.
            user_context: Optional user context ID to scope the permission.
            embedded_origin: Keyword-only. Embedded origin for cross-origin
                iframes; scopes the permission to that iframe's origin.

        Raises:
            ValueError: If *state* is not a valid permission state.
        """
        state_value = state.value if isinstance(state, PermissionState) else state
        valid_states = {"granted", "denied", "prompt"}
        if state_value not in valid_states:
            raise ValueError(
                f"Invalid permission state: {state_value!r}. "
                f"Must be one of {sorted(valid_states)}"
            )

        descriptor_dict = {"name": descriptor} if isinstance(descriptor, str) else {"name": descriptor.name}

        params: dict = {
            "descriptor": descriptor_dict,
            "state": state_value,
        }
        if origin is not None:
            params["origin"] = origin
        if embedded_origin is not None:
            params["embeddedOrigin"] = embedded_origin
        if user_context is not None:
            params["userContext"] = user_context

        cmd = command_builder("permissions.setPermission", params)
        self._conn.execute(cmd)
